A CSPS Webinar on "Invisible labour: Africa’s role in training the global AI economy"

A CSPS Webinar on "Invisible labour: Africa’s role in training the global AI economy"

As AI transforms global industries, its growth depends on invisible labour and extractive infrastructures, many anchored in Africa. This webinar, Invisible Labour: Africa’s Role in Training the Global AI Economy, exposes how African workers and resources power AI, from cobalt and coltan mines in the DRC to data annotation hubs in Kenya. It also highlights the continent’s role as a dumping ground for toxic e-waste, with sites like Agbogbloshie absorbing the detritus of digital consumption. Drawing on interdisciplinary research, lived realities, and critical policy perspectives, the session asks: What does ethical AI mean when built on exploitation? And how can African agency reshape digital futures?
